Chronic Pain: Acupuncture is effective in managing chronic pain conditions like back pain, neck pain, and osteoarthritis by reducing inflammation and promoting blood flow to affected areas.
Migraines and Headaches: It can help alleviate the frequency and intensity of migraines and tension headaches by balancing energy flow and relieving muscle tension.
Postoperative Pain: Accelerates recovery and reduces discomfort following surgical procedures by enhancing circulation and speeding up tissue repair.
Dental Pain: Provides relief from dental pain by targeting specific points related to the jaw and oral health.
Fibromyalgia: Helps manage the widespread pain and fatigue associated with fibromyalgia by addressing underlying imbalances in the body.
Anxiety and Depression: Balances neurotransmitters and promotes relaxation, which can help alleviate symptoms of anxiety and depression.
Insomnia: Improves sleep quality by calming the nervous system and addressing underlying factors that contribute to insomnia.
Stress Management: Reduces stress levels by promoting relaxation and balancing the body’s stress response systems.
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S): Can help manage symptoms like abdominal pain and bloating by regulating digestive function and reducing inflammation.
Nausea and Vomiting: Effective for relieving nausea and vomiting, whether due to chemotherapy, postoperative recovery, or other causes.
Constipation: Enhances digestive motility and relieves constipation by stimulating specific points that support bowel function.
Menstrual Cramps (Dysmenorrhea): Provides relief from menstrual pain by improving blood flow and reducing uterine contractions.
Infertility: Supports reproductive health and fertility by balancing hormonal levels and enhancing uterine blood flow.
Menopausal Symptoms: Helps manage symptoms like hot flashes, night sweats, and mood swings by balancing hormonal fluctuations.
Labor Induction Acupuncture: Facilitates the natural onset of labor by stimulating key acupuncture points, encouraging uterine contractions, and promoting the body’s readiness for childbirth.
Hypertension: Helps lower blood pressure by promoting relaxation and improving overall cardiovascular health.
Addictions (e.g., Smoking Cessation): Supports the process of quitting smoking by reducing cravings and withdrawal symptoms.
Boosting Immune System Function: Enhances overall immune function, making it easier for the body to fight off infections and illnesses.

Acupuncture, a supplementary medicine with deep roots in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), is becoming increasingly popular among couples who are trying to become parents. To promote energy flow and equilibrium, acupuncture entails delicately inserting tiny needles into certain areas all over the body. It seeks to establish a balanced internal environment to improve the odds of conceiving.
Acupuncture's potential benefits for fertility are multifaceted. It may help regulate menstrual cycles, improve egg quality, increase blood flow to the reproductive organs, and reduce stress – a known factor hindering conception. By promoting relaxation and overall well-being, acupuncture can create a more conducive environment for conception.
During your first appointment, a trained acupuncturist will ask about your health, habits, and infertility issues. The next step is for them to create an individualized treatment program that will address your unique concerns. You can relax as the acupuncturist places tiny needles at specific locations on your body. For many, it is a vital and reawakening experience.
While often associated with female fertility, acupuncture can also enhance male fertility. Studies suggest that acupuncture may improve sperm count, motility, and morphology. It may also help reduce stress and improve overall health, positively impacting sperm production.
Traditional reproductive therapies, such in vitro fertilization (IVF), can greatly benefit from acupuncture. By promoting a healthy pregnancy and making the body more receptive to implantation, it may increase the success rates of these treatments.
